Why fly to Karup?
The single route out of KRP goes straight to Copenhagen, covering just 232 kilometers. That might sound limited, but for travelers in Jutland, it's the difference between a 45-minute flight and a four-plus hour drive or train ride across the country. Copenhagen connects onward to basically everywhere — Asia, North America, the Middle East — so catching a quick domestic hop here before an international connection is a genuinely smart move. The airline operating the route is 6I, which keeps things simple. There's also something to be said for skipping the chaos of Aarhus or Billund when you live closer to Karup and just need to get moving.

Tips for travelers at KRP
The airport is close to the town of Kølvrå and serves the broader Viborg and Silkeborg areas. Renting a car is your best bet for reaching it — public transit options in rural Jutland are sparse and slow. Book early if you're traveling in summer, since the route fills up with Danes heading to and from Copenhagen for holidays and work. Winter flying here can mean wind delays, so build buffer time into any connections. And don't expect lounges or retail therapy inside. Grab coffee before you arrive.
